- Estonia will raise its standard VAT rate from 22 percent to 24 percent starting 1 July 2025
- Reduced VAT rates will rise from 9 percent to 13 percent and from 5 percent to 9 percent
- Additional revenue will be used to fund long-range weapons systems and munitions
